Getting a driving license in Switzerland is legally bound by a specified process. The steps usually include:
- Eligibility Requirements: You should be at least 18 years old and have legal residency in Switzerland.
- Theory Test: Candidates should pass a theoretical evaluation that covers traffic guidelines and regulations.
- Dry run: Successful conclusion of a driving test is required, demonstrating the ability to deal with a lorry securely.
- Paperwork: Submission of essential files, including evidence of identity, residency, and potential medical certificates.
- Charges: Payment of the fees related to document processing and screening.

The Risks of Buying a Driving License
Though the idea of acquiring a driving license is appealing to some, it's necessary to comprehend the significant dangers included:
- Legality: Buying a driving license is unlawful. Participating in this activity can cause criminal charges.
- Deceitful Licenses: Many deals happen in black markets, where purchasers run the risk of getting forged or void files.
- Financial Loss: There's a high possibility of losing money without receiving a genuine license in return.
- Driving Without a License: If captured driving with an illegal license, people may deal with serious penalties, consisting of fines and imprisonment.
- Insurance coverage Issues: Driving without a correct license can void car insurance coverage, leaving individuals liable in the event of a mishap.

Q1: Is it possible to convert a foreign driving license to a Swiss one?
A: Yes, people holding a valid driving license from specific countries can obtain conversion. However, some might need to take a theory or driving test, depending upon their home country's arrangements with Switzerland.
Q2: What are the penalties for using a fake driving license?
A: The penalties can vary however might include hefty fines, criminal charges, and potential jail time. Additionally, individuals will deal with automated disqualification from obtaining a legitimate license in the future.
Q3: How long does it require to process a genuine Swiss driving license application?
A: The time frame can differ, but generally, it may take numerous weeks to a few months, depending upon the canton and the efficiency of your application.
Q4: Can I drive in Switzerland with an international driving permit (IDP)?
A: Yes, travelers can use an IDP in combination with their home nation's driving license for a restricted period while going to Switzerland.
